Overview

Research Assistant helps graduate students and early-career researchers answer two questions every author faces: "Where should I publish this?" and "What should I be citing?" — without ever sending your manuscript to a server.

Everything runs on your own device. There is no backend, no account, and no tracking. Your draft text never leaves your laptop; only short, anonymous phrase queries are sent to public research databases, exactly like typing a search into PubMed.

★ THREE TOOLS, ONE SIDE PANEL

1. Where could I publish this? (Journal Matcher)
Paste your abstract and introduction. An AI sentence-embedding model runs locally in your browser and ranks a curated set of journals by how well your draft fits their scope — with similarity scores, open-access status, approximate article-processing charges, decision times, and a direct link to each journal's submission page.

2. What should I cite? (Prior-Art Finder)
Paste a section of your draft. Research Assistant samples distinctive phrases and searches PubMed, OpenAlex and Crossref in parallel for prior work that resembles your writing — so you can find the literature you should be citing. Filter by source and year, sort by relevance or recency, and export to BibTeX, RIS or CSV.

3. My drafts library (Self-overlap check)
Keep a private, on-device library of your own earlier papers, preprints and theses. When you check a new draft, Research Assistant highlights passages that overlap with your own prior work — useful for thesis writers reusing conference-paper material who need to disclose or cite it correctly. This runs fully offline.

★ WHAT THIS IS NOT

Research Assistant is a discovery and self-check assistant — not a plagiarism checker and not an AI-content detector. It surfaces similarity and prior work to help you improve and cite correctly; it never accuses your writing of plagiarism, and it contains no AI-text "detector" (those have high false-positive rates against non-native English writers, and we will not ship one).

★ HOW IT WORKS UNDER THE HOOD

- On-device sentence embeddings via transformers.js (WebGPU, falling back to WASM). The default model (~30 MB) downloads once from Hugging Face and is then cached for offline use.
- In-browser MinHash for self-overlap, PDF text extraction via pdf.js, and IndexedDB for local storage.
- Public APIs: PubMed E-utilities, OpenAlex and Crossref. You can add your own free NCBI key for faster PubMed searches.
